Curious about nature-inspired drug breakthroughs? Enter NYB.AI!
Nanyang Biologics' DTIGN outperforms traditional methods by 25% by focusing on nature-derived compounds, enhancing drug-target interaction predictions and revolutionizing drug discovery in Southeast Asia. Their innovative approach is setting new standards in the industry, as highlighted in the article on revolutionizing drug discovery with AI.
Why this shift: Reimagining pharma, consumer, and animal health with AI not only promises faster molecule discovery but also contributes to biodiversity conservation by utilizing natural resources sustainably. NYB.AI aims to create the world's largest Library of Life, promoting affordable treatments while supporting ecological efforts.

Generative AI (GenAI) is paving the way for personalized healthcare by predicting drug responses based on [PATIENT_DATA]. By utilizing individual genetic profiles, lifestyles, and environmental factors, GenAI enables healthcare providers to create tailored treatment plans that significantly enhance patient outcomes – a serious game-changer in medicine!
The benefits of AI in medicine are profound: faster diagnoses, reduced trial and error, and success stories are on the rise. Advanced AI models, like Multi-Omics Integrated Collective Variational Autoencoders (MOICVAE), can predict drug sensitivity across various cancers, demonstrating how targeted approaches minimize risks and maximize effectiveness.
This shift towards personalized treatments is transforming healthcare by delivering more precise therapies with fewer side effects. As AI collaborates with medical professionals, adverse effects are expected to decrease, fulfilling the promise of precision medicine.
